Made from durable, maintenance-free Carbelite«, a hand-layered composition of Kevlar, fiberglass and graphite that guarantees the ultimate in strength and performance, unaffected by changes in weather and humidity. All stocks feature black, textured finish, raised checkering, sling swivel studs and rubber recoil pad. Lifetime warranty on materials and workmanship. Fits standard Mauser 98 Actions.
